The Illusion of Ease: Why Bitcoin's Latest Difficulty Dip is No Panacea for Miners In early January 2026, the Bitcoin network delivered what seemed, on the surface, like a welcome reprieve: its first difficulty recalibration of the new year saw the metric slip to just over 146 trillion . From a purely technical standpoint, this slight easing was a direct result of average block times briefly running faster than the targeted 10 minutes, clocking in at around 9.88 minutes . For those unfamiliar with the minutiae, a faster block production rate signals to the protocol that mining is getting "too easy," thus prompting a downward adjustment in difficulty to restore equilibrium. Bitcoin's Technical Resilience: Reclaiming Key Levels

From a technical standpoint, Bitcoin has also been displaying structural fortitude. Ardi pointed out the reclaim and hold of the 200 Simple Moving Average (200-SMA) on the 4-hour chart. This isn't just a line on a chart; it's a battle line, a reliable trend filter that has dictated momentum throughout this cycle. When this indicator slopes downwards, price action struggles, and downside flushes become routine. But when it's reclaimed and begins to turn upwards, the market shifts into a phase of sustained momentum.

🚀 The current market phenomenon—Bitcoin holding firm while altcoin liquidity bleeds, quietly setting the stage for a broader market rotation—bears a striking resemblance to the "Altcoin Bleed" period of late 2016 and early 2017. In 2017, Bitcoin was steadily grinding upwards, breaking all-time highs, while many altcoins, despite their innovative promises, bled value against BTC. The outcome was a multi-month period where Bitcoin dominance soared. Retail investors, tired of their altcoins lagging, often sold them for BTC, effectively feeding the king. Then, in an explosive pivot, capital cascaded from Bitcoin into altcoins, leading to the legendary "Altcoin Season" of mid-2017, where many small-cap assets saw 10x to 100x gains in a matter of weeks.

📘 Glossary for Serious Investors

🤫 Liquidity Trap (Crypto): A market condition where capital is quietly drawn into a dominant asset (like Bitcoin), often deleveraging from smaller, riskier assets, before being strategically reallocated in a future, more opportunistic phase.

📈 200 Simple Moving Average (200-SMA): A widely used technical indicator representing the average price over the last 200 periods (e.g., 200 4-hour candles). It acts as a significant trend filter; reclaiming and holding it usually signals a shift towards sustained momentum.
